WebAug 19, 2024 · The Fannie Mae HomeReady® mortgage program caters to lower-income homebuyers who don’t have a large down payment saved up. Qualified buyers only need a 3% down payment, which is less than the 3.5% down payment minimum required for loans backed by the Federal Housing Administration (FHA). WebManufactured homes. are permitted per Fannie Mae MH Advantage and Fannie Mae Standard MH-guidelines with the following parameters: — Single-wide manufactured homes are not eligible — Fannie Mae Desktop Underwriter® (DU®) with Approve/Eligible Findings only — Maximum DTI: 45.00% — Leaseholds are not permitted —

WebOct 24, 2024 · The Federal Housing Finance Agency regulates Fannie Mae, Freddie Mac and the 11 Federal Home Loan Banks. These government-sponsored enterprises provide more than $7.9 trillion in funding for the U.S. mortgage markets and financial institutions.
